Unveiling Network Secrets: A Comprehensive Guide To Network Scanning With Nmap
Unveiling Network Secrets: A Comprehensive Guide to Network Scanning with Nmap
Related Articles: Unveiling Network Secrets: A Comprehensive Guide to Network Scanning with Nmap
Introduction
In this auspicious occasion, we are delighted to delve into the intriguing topic related to Unveiling Network Secrets: A Comprehensive Guide to Network Scanning with Nmap. Let’s weave interesting information and offer fresh perspectives to the readers.
Table of Content
Unveiling Network Secrets: A Comprehensive Guide to Network Scanning with Nmap
In the intricate world of computer networks, understanding the landscape of connected devices is paramount. This requires a powerful tool capable of revealing the hidden intricacies of a network, and Nmap, the Network Mapper, stands as the industry standard for network scanning. This comprehensive guide delves into the capabilities of Nmap, exploring its uses, functionalities, and the profound impact it has on network security and administration.
The Essence of Network Scanning
Network scanning involves systematically probing network devices, gathering information about their presence, services, and vulnerabilities. This process is akin to conducting a digital census, illuminating the network’s composition and identifying potential security risks. Nmap excels in this domain, providing a versatile and robust platform for network exploration.
Nmap’s Arsenal: A Toolkit for Network Exploration
Nmap boasts a wide range of functionalities, enabling users to conduct various types of network scans. These include:
- Port Scanning: This fundamental technique identifies open ports on target devices, revealing the services running on those ports. Nmap can scan individual ports or entire port ranges, providing a detailed inventory of services available.
- Host Discovery: Nmap effectively locates active devices on a network, determining their IP addresses and MAC addresses. This functionality aids in network mapping and identifying potential intruders.
- Operating System Detection: Nmap can identify the operating system running on target devices by analyzing network responses. This knowledge is crucial for tailoring security measures and exploiting potential vulnerabilities.
- Version Detection: Nmap extends its capabilities by identifying the specific versions of services running on target devices. This information allows for targeted security assessments and the identification of known vulnerabilities.
- Vulnerability Scanning: Nmap integrates with external databases and scripts to identify known vulnerabilities in services and applications running on target devices. This proactive approach helps organizations mitigate security risks before they are exploited.
Beyond the Basics: Advanced Nmap Techniques
Nmap’s versatility extends beyond basic scanning. Advanced techniques provide in-depth insights into network behavior and security posture:
- Stealth Scanning: Nmap can perform scans in a stealthy manner, minimizing the chances of detection by firewalls or intrusion detection systems. This technique is invaluable for reconnaissance and penetration testing.
- Script Scanning: Nmap integrates with a library of scripts, enabling automated vulnerability checks and gathering additional information about target devices. These scripts can identify specific vulnerabilities, gather configuration details, or even exploit weaknesses.
- Service and Application Fingerprinting: Nmap can analyze network responses to identify the specific versions and configurations of services and applications running on target devices. This detailed information is crucial for security assessments and vulnerability analysis.
- Network Mapping: Nmap excels at creating visual representations of network topology, providing a comprehensive overview of devices, connections, and services. This capability is vital for network management and troubleshooting.
The Importance of Nmap: A Multifaceted Tool
Nmap’s significance transcends mere network exploration. It plays a critical role in several critical areas:
- Network Security: Nmap is a cornerstone of network security assessments, enabling organizations to identify vulnerabilities, assess risks, and implement appropriate security measures.
- Network Administration: Nmap assists network administrators in mapping network topology, monitoring device status, and troubleshooting network issues.
- Penetration Testing: Security professionals utilize Nmap for penetration testing, identifying potential attack vectors and simulating real-world attacks to improve security posture.
- Research and Development: Nmap empowers researchers and developers to analyze network behavior, identify emerging threats, and develop new security solutions.
FAQs: Demystifying Nmap
Q: Is Nmap legal to use?
A: Nmap is a legitimate tool for network scanning. However, its use must comply with local laws and regulations. It is crucial to obtain explicit permission before scanning private networks or performing scans that could disrupt network operations.
Q: How can I learn to use Nmap effectively?
A: Nmap offers comprehensive documentation, tutorials, and online resources. The official Nmap website and numerous online communities provide valuable guidance and support for users at all skill levels.
Q: What are the risks associated with using Nmap?
A: Improper use of Nmap can lead to unintended consequences, such as network disruptions or security breaches. It is essential to understand the potential risks and use Nmap responsibly.
Q: How can I prevent Nmap scans from affecting my network?
A: Employing strong firewalls, intrusion detection systems, and network segmentation can mitigate the impact of Nmap scans. Additionally, configuring systems to block suspicious traffic and implementing security best practices can further enhance network security.
Tips for Effective Nmap Usage
- Start with basic scans: Begin with simple port scans to understand the network landscape before venturing into more complex techniques.
- Utilize Nmap’s scripting capabilities: Leverage Nmap’s extensive script library to automate vulnerability checks and gather valuable information.
- Document your findings: Maintain detailed records of scan results, including timestamps, target devices, and identified vulnerabilities.
- Stay updated: Regularly update Nmap to benefit from new features, security enhancements, and script updates.
Conclusion
Nmap remains an indispensable tool for network exploration and security assessment. Its versatility, comprehensive features, and ongoing development ensure its continued relevance in the evolving landscape of network security. By mastering Nmap’s capabilities, individuals and organizations can gain valuable insights into their networks, identify potential vulnerabilities, and proactively protect their systems from malicious actors.
Closure
Thus, we hope this article has provided valuable insights into Unveiling Network Secrets: A Comprehensive Guide to Network Scanning with Nmap. We hope you find this article informative and beneficial. See you in our next article!